## Build Provenance — Gaugelet Metrics Sidecar

Every published Gaugelet sidecar image is built in an isolated pipeline that records the source revision, toolchain versions, and the exact dependency lockfile used. Plugin authors should verify provenance before linking against a sidecar release, since the aggregation ABI can shift between minor builds. Attestations are signed at build time and shipped alongside the image manifest. The attestation references a short provenance token, which is reproduced for convenience directly below.

session token of tagef-hahag = htk4_f22a

Team — during next Tuesday's disaster-recovery drill for Ledgerline, we'll re-verify timezone handling in report exports. Past drills surfaced off-by-one-day totals when the restored region defaulted to UTC while schedules assumed local time. Confirm the export worker reads the tenant timezone after failover, not the host clock. Restoring the export config store requires unsealing it first, and the recovery passphrase for that step is:

recovery phrase for tafof-tagag: kaseth-brivan-pelmir-istmir-istax-pelath-sorael-praax-sorix-norwyn-frador-praok-istir-juleth

TURN-208: Gatevale turnstile counters at the Merrow Field pilot double-count when a rotation reverses mid-cycle. Attendance totals drift roughly 2% high per event. The debounce window fix is implemented, reviewed by Ilsa, and soak-tested across two simulated match days without drift. Ready for your cut; the candidate build is identified below.

trace token, tagag-tafog: htk6_5ed18c